LEWISBURG W.Va. (WVDN) — The Greenbrier Humane Society is excited to invite the community to a festive Holiday Open House on Saturday, Dec. 6th, from 12 to 5 p.m. This family-friendly event will be held at the Greenbrier Humane Society and is open to animal lovers of all ages.
Guests will enjoy a variety of holiday activities, including:
Photos with Santa – Capture a Christmas memory with the jolly man himself.
Kids’ Coloring Station – A creative and fun space for young visitors.
Goodie Bags – Free take-home treats while supplies last.
In addition to the holiday cheer, all animals at the shelter will be viewable and adoptable throughout the event. It’s the perfect opportunity to meet pets in need of loving homes and learn more about the shelter’s mission.
“We’re thrilled to open our doors to the community for a day of celebration, connection, and compassion,” said Logan Morgan, Event Coordinator at the Greenbrier Humane Society. “Whether you’re looking to adopt, support the shelter, or just enjoy some holiday fun, we welcome everyone to join us.”
